Example input & output

Example input

Campaign Goal & KPI
Increase free-trial signups for a project management tool by 20%.
Audience Profile
Busy team leads at 10-50 person startups; biggest objection: "too hard to onboard."
Product Value Proposition
Set up in 10 minutes, templates included, clear dashboards, integrates with Slack.
Channel & Placement Context
Landing page hero + CTA button.
Existing Copy or Control Variant (Optional)
Control: "Manage projects in one place."
Success Signals / Metrics to Optimise
Primary: trial signup rate. Secondary: time on page, CTA clicks.
Deliverable Formats
3 headline options + CTA options + hypothesis.
Preferred Tone
Clear & confident

Example output

A/B test variations (example)

Headline options

  • Option 1: "Launch projects in 10 minutes-without a messy setup."
  • Option 2: "Templates + dashboards that keep your team on track."
  • Option 3: "Project clarity for busy leads-integrates with Slack."

CTA options

  • "Start free trial"
  • "Try it in 10 minutes"
  • "Get templates + dashboards"

Hypothesis Reducing perceived onboarding effort ("10 minutes") will increase trial signups among time‑constrained team leads.

Evaluation rubric

  • Clarity of benefit (1-5)
  • Match to objection (1-5)
  • Strength of CTA (1-5)

Test Planning Blueprint

Align stakeholders: spell out each variant's hypothesis, positioning differences, and measurement plan.

Variant Strategy

  • Variant A: baseline emphasising primary value proposition and strongest proof point.
  • Variant B: experimental hook tailored to interests/region/consumption habits.
  • Variant C (optional): bold hypothesis combining new CTA or incentive.

Evaluation Rubric

  • Message clarity: does the copy resolve persona pain quickly?
  • Differentiation: how well does it highlight unique value or localisation?
  • Conversion driver: strength of CTA, urgency, or incentive alignment.

Optimisation Workflow

  • Deploy variants simultaneously with clean traffic splits.
  • Monitor leading indicators (CTR, scroll depth) before full CVR convergence.
  • Log insights to fuel next iteration, doubling down on winning angles.
